Beta testers for hardware and software products are individuals or groups who evaluate pre-release versions of products to identify bugs, usability issues, and potential improvements. Their feedback helps manufacturers and developers refine and enhance the final release, ensuring higher quality and user satisfaction.
Key Features
- Early Access: Provides testers with access to unreleased products before official launch.
- Feedback Loop: Facilitates continuous feedback from users to creators.
- Bug Identification: Helps detect software glitches or hardware malfunctions.
- Usability Testing: Assesses user experience, interface design, and feature functionality.
- Iterative Improvement: Supports multiple testing cycles for product refinement.
Pros
- Enhances product quality through real-world testing
- Gathers diverse user feedback leading to more robust features
- Reduces post-release bugs and issues
- Allows manufacturers to address compatibility and usability concerns early on
- Engages a community of tech enthusiasts and early adopters
Cons
- Potential delay in product release due to extensive testing cycles
- Testers may not represent all end-user demographics
- Managing large volumes of feedback can be challenging
- Beta versions might contain unstable features that could frustrate testers
- Possibility of confidential information leaks if not properly managed
